Output 51fc726a3471d1b068d57374c0942b51e2075b7e38db87bcd623ef66f80a4fcb:4
- value
- 9590686
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 faf238e80e233bfc7110179bdf8325ef25655d68 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Pst6rjNajvfFbxkh1rzE9HMGbprpUD5Lk
- transaction
- 51fc726a3471d1b068d57374c0942b51e2075b7e38db87bcd623ef66f80a4fcb
- confirmations
- 397812
- spent
- true